The Texas Ethics Commission's recent crackdown on a North Texas political consultant is a good example of why we strongly support this state agency. It's also why we again urge Attorney General Ken Paxton to do the same. The commission last month fined Matt Armstrong of GrassRoutes Public Relations in Flower Mound a staggering $37,500 in connection with his involvement in three political action committees: McKinney Citizens United, We Love Farmers Branch and Citizens for a Better Farmers Branch.
